Transaction 16609ecde0cd01492b18ca3d53ec65f4f0e4e74f94d8151d3d6a9ac5f6814afa
1 Input
1 Output
-
16609ecde0cd01492b18ca3d53ec65f4f0e4e74f94d8151d3d6a9ac5f6814afa:0
- value
- 27573929
- script pubkey
- OP_0 OP_PUSHBYTES_20 23f706a2cb84f94d11bdda1a9909ffa652258f1d
- address
- bc1qy0msdgktsnu56ydamgdfjz0l5efztrcam9kf67